Randomly I will go to begin moving and there is no torque, the engine revs high but moves very slow w/ no torque. Almost like its trying to start in 2nd gear (auto trans) When it does this, the Overdrive light blinks on and off.

It does it when warm, cool cold, when first driving, and after driving a long ways. I will do it for 1 start, or 5 starts. There is NO consistency WHATSOEVER that I can find.

VERY strange to me...trans oil clean and tranny shifts very good all the time over wise. Anyone else experienced this?
